研究采用了高内涵成像(HCI)技术,这是一种结合自动化显微镜与图像分析的高通量方法。它能同时检测多个细胞学参数,如形态、大小、荧光强度、纹理与定位等,从而量化药物对细胞的多维影响。 论文中提到,研究者利用 “Cell Painting”技术进行细胞染色,使每个样本在五个通道下成像,生成包含丰富表型特征的数据集。这一技术极大地提高了实验通量,并为后续的机器学习模型提供了高维度数据基础。
